If it’.s a stuffed bird, the stuffing should be removed immediately from the cavity, placed in a covered bowl and stored in the refrigerator. Refrigerated turkey and dressing should be usecwithin one or two days. If you want to store the turkey longer-and if you have a lot left over, you probably will-freeze it. Remove all the meat from the bones as soon as possible after the dinner, and carefully slice the “sliceable” meat. Dice or grind the remaining meat. Divide the turkey into portions suitable for the family mealtime needs, carefully wrap each portion in freezer foil and label each package. Then the turkey will be ready to use in tasty dishes like Turkey a la King. Turkey a la King (6 servings) 1 cup frozen green peas, 2 tablespoons finely chopped onion, V4 cup chopped green pepper, one third cup boiling water, two thirds cup flour, 1 cup cold milk, 2 cups turkey broth, 2 teaspoons salt, pepper, as desired, Vi> teaspoon poultry seasoning, 2 cups diced cooked turkey, 1 can (four ounces) mushroom stems and pieces, drained and chopped, 1 tablespoon chopped pimiento, cooked rice, toast or biscuits. Cook peas, onion and green pepper in boiling water in a covered pan 5 minutes. Drain; save the liquid. Blend flour with milk. Combine vegetable cooking liquid, broth and seasonings; slowly stir in flour mixture. Bring to a boil, stirring constantly; cook 1 minute. Add turkey, cooked vegetables, mushrooms and pimiento. Heat thoroughly and serve on rice, toast or biscuits. FEEDING TIME . . .
